Genome Mining of Alkaloidal Terpenoids from a Hybrid Terpene and Nonribosomal Peptide Biosynthetic Pathway
Biosynthetic pathways containing multiple core enzymes have potential to produce structurally complex natural products. Here we mined a fungal gene cluster that contains two predicted terpene cyclases (TCs) and a nonribosomal peptide synthetase (NRPS). We showed the fly pathway produces flavunoidine 1, an alkaloidal terpenoid. The core of 1 is a tetracyclic, cage-like, and oxygenated sesquiterpene that is connected to dimethylcadaverine via a C-N bond and is acylated with 5,5-dimethyl-L-pipecolate. The roles of all flv enzymes are established on the basis of metabolite analysis from heterologous expression.
